Durga Saptashati 1.34

Chapter 1, Verse 34

Chapter 1: Madhu-Kaiṭabha Vadhaमधुकैटभवध

राजोवाच भगवंस्त्वामहं प्रष्टुमिच्छाम्येकं वदस्व तत्

🔊 Tap any word to hear it — or ▶ to recite the whole shloka

Transliteration

rājovāca bhagavaṃstvāmahaṃ praṣṭumicchāmyekaṃ vadasva tat

Meaning

The king said: O revered one, I wish to ask you one thing; pray tell me that.
